The cost of installing a cat flap can vary according to the type of cat flap you select and the door or wall material. Standard pet flaps are less expensive than those that have locks or features like microchip access. There are  Repair My Windows And Doors UK  of pet flaps on the market, so it's important to choose one that fits your needs and the pets you have.

Another thing to consider when deciding on the type of pet flap is the size. It is important to select an area that is large enough to let your pet pass through comfortably. This will to avoid injuries and accidents. It is also important to measure the dimensions and height of your cat prior to purchasing a pet flap.

The installation of a cat flap could be a bit complicated, particularly in the case of a surface that is difficult to cut. You'll pay more to install a pet flap on a door with an extremely hard surface, such as glass or uPVC. Additionally, the area of your home will also impact the cost of labor. For example, you'll probably be paying more for a professional to install a cat flap in London than in the north of England.

A skilled cat flap fitter can install a new cat flap for a reasonable price. It is crucial to hire a professional in order to ensure the flap is installed correctly. A poorly fitted cat flap could allow drafts into your home and create an entry point for unwanted guests.

The cost of installing the pet flap will vary based on the type of pet flap and the area it will be installed on. An easy installation on a wooden door could cost around PS80 for an installation that is more complex an external wall or a French glass door could cost as high as PS250. The overall labour cost will be influenced by the size of the pet flap, and whether or not it is equipped with an locking mechanism.

If you're looking to purchase a new cat flap for your home, it's crucial to know the price you should expect to pay. The cost of the flap will differ according to its size and type. A basic two-way flap for pets could be bought for as low as PS10 while more sophisticated models may cost up to PS250. It's also important to consider the area you're putting the flap onto because some surfaces are more difficult to cut than others.
